The multi-zone system allows users to manage different temperature and humidity levels within the same home.
The values of each zone are set on the master CH180RFWIFI and modified locally by one or more devices installed inside the rooms. Communication between all the devices occurs via radio waves.

Installation must be carried out by qualified personnel in compliance with the requirements concerning installation of electrical devices.Make sure that the power supply is disconnected before performing the installation.
The CH180RFWIFI programmable thermostat must be wall or recess mounted, with 3 modules or round box, at a height of about 1.5 m from the floor, in a position suitable to correctly detect the room temperature.

ERROR | DEVICE | FAULT | ACTION |
020 | O60RF | Incorrect assembly | Make sure that the head is mounted properly on the valve; contact technical support if the problem persists. |
010/ 021/ 030 | O60RF | Mechanical / electronic error | Contact technical support. |
022 | O60RF | Temperature reading error | Contact technical support. |
040 | O60RF | Low battery | Replace the batteries. |
001 | CH120RF | Low battery | Replace the batteries. |
006 | CH120RF | No radio communication | Replace the batteries; contact technical support if the problem persists. |
050 | O60RF | No radio communication | Replace the batteries; contact technical support if the problem persists. |
050 | CH175 | No radio communication | Check the mains power supply; contact technical support if the problem persists. |

OFFSET
Allows to modify the temperature measured by CH180RFWIFI and by the heads O60RF which act as a zone. Due to an incorrect wall installation or assembly of the heads on radiators located in non-ideal positions (behind walls, curtains or in crannies), the sensors might not indicate the correct temperature perceived by the devices. This function corrects the measured temperature for the selected zone by ± 5.0 °C (default = 0.0 °C).

COOL OFF
Allows you to control floor system condensate formation in SUMMER without having a floor probe.
If COOL OFF = YES, the CH180RFWIFI controls the cooling system shut down at the same time as dehumidifier activation (it is necessary to set an RH% threshold and the DEW function must be disabled).
Note: with the control active, when a zone switches the cooling system off, the symbol flashes in the corresponding zone.

The symbol of the crossed-out wheeled bin indicates that the products must be collected and disposed of separately from household waste. The batteries and integrated accumulators may be disposed of together with the product. They will be separated at the recycling facilities. A black bar indicates that the product was placed on the market after August 13th, 2005. Participating in the separate collection of products and batteries contributes to the correct disposal of these materials and therefore avoids possible negative consequences for the environment and human health. For more detailed information on the collection and recycling programmes available in your country, contact the local authorities or the sales point where you purchased the product.
The conventional warranty lasts 24 months, starting from the date the equipment is installed. The warranty covers all parts of the equipment, with the exception of those subjected to normal wear.
